The jet pump water intake (1) draws water
into the propulsion system. A grate (2) helps
to screen out debris.

The cooling water bypass outlet (1) is used to
check that water is circulating properly in the
engine cooling system while the engine is
running. If you don’t see water flowing out of
the outlet, stop the engine.
Check for possible causes of the problem
(page 236).
